Gunbound Legend: Vua Toạ Độ: A Strategic Mobile Revival
Gunbound Legend: Vua Toạ Độ is a modern mobile revival of the classic artillery strategy game, bringing intense turn-based PvP battles to your fingertips. This title challenges players to master angles, wind physics, and a diverse roster of tanks to outsmart opponents in tactical combat.
Overview and Basic Information
Gunbound Legend: Vua Toạ Độ is a strategic artillery game developed for mobile platforms. It faithfully recreates the core gameplay of the beloved PC classic, where players control unique tanks in turn-based duels. Success hinges on precise calculation of shot trajectories, accounting for distance, angle, and wind force. Gunbound Legend offers various modes, including ranked PvP, team battles, and challenging PvE missions, all designed to test a player's tactical acumen.

Disadvantages
New players may face a steep learning curve against experienced opponents who have mastered shot mechanics.
Progress can be slow for free-to-play users, as acquiring top-tier tanks may require significant grinding or luck.
Matches can sometimes feel dependent on random wind patterns, which may lead to frustrating outcomes.
As with many competitive games, Gunbound Legend: Vua Toạ Độ can have balance issues following major updates.
Some players might find the turn-based pace slower compared to real-time action games.

Tips for Using
Spend time in practice mode to master the fundamental shot mechanics without pressure.
Learn the strengths, weaknesses, and special shots of a few tanks instead of trying to master them all at once.
Always pay close attention to the wind direction and strength before taking your shot; it is a critical factor.
Use the terrain to your advantage for defensive positioning or to create tricky bank shots.
Join a guild to learn from other players, share strategies, and participate in team events.
Manage your resources wisely and be patient when attempting to acquire new tanks from the gacha system.
